Aerial Infrared Roof Inspections

BDG’s aerial drone thermal infrared roof inspections are ideal for determining active roof leaks during due diligence of commercial or multi-family property acquisitions and can significantly reduce the time and expense of commercial roof inspections when compared to conventional methods. This thermal imaging service is performed just after sunset to detect warm trapped moisture under the roofing membrane. We can detect otherwise unobservable areas of water damage without requiring roof access or causing disruption to the occupants of the building.
